Transaction fd50c15111d7f61deb49ec55c568dc31307d5f22e5ad0a8eddef1b84555c0be1

block
60bdda8dd51aae6526b4f57b5fdd46078f4a6370419211754867983e55099c70

3 Inputs

999 Outputs